Size: a a a

2021 March 19

VS

Vladislav 👻 Shishkov... in Airflow
хз, мы такое не делаем и не собираемся делать
источник

SK

Sergej Kutepov in Airflow
Всем привет
Подскажите, пожалуйста, как корректно прописать условие для sqlsensor
источник
2021 March 20

EG

Eugene Girtcius in Airflow
товарищи, может у кого есть пример, как воркеров раскидывать по удаленным машинам?
в примерах, которые нашел все воркеры сложены в один compose файл и плодятся на одном сервере
ну или совсем дебри с кубером, которого, я, к сожалению, не знаю

может, что-то рабочее на основе docker swarm имеется?
источник

GB

Georgy Borodin in Airflow
Eugene Girtcius
товарищи, может у кого есть пример, как воркеров раскидывать по удаленным машинам?
в примерах, которые нашел все воркеры сложены в один compose файл и плодятся на одном сервере
ну или совсем дебри с кубером, которого, я, к сожалению, не знаю

может, что-то рабочее на основе docker swarm имеется?
Ну у тебя обычные celery worker-ы, которым нужен доступ к питон-коду, очереди и в случае с эирфлоу вроде как точно с бэкендом для результатов.
Запускай, где угодно, главное, чтобы совпадали настройки, ну и воркеры были в той же сети, как и очередь с базой
источник

ME

Max Efremov in Airflow
источник

ME

Max Efremov in Airflow
Вот красивая картинка с коннектами
источник

ME

Max Efremov in Airflow
Не важно, где всё будет, главное, чтобы могло законнектиться
источник

ME

Max Efremov in Airflow
источник

ME

Max Efremov in Airflow
Отсюда
источник

GB

Georgy Borodin in Airflow
Max Efremov
Вот красивая картинка с коннектами
Вот если бы я не мямлил – попал бы в яблочко без вопросов 😂
источник

ME

Max Efremov in Airflow
А на практике у нас пока тоже докер компоуз на 1 машинке 😅
источник

EG

Eugene Girtcius in Airflow
да, это я видел, вопрос, как утилизировать)
когда airflow локально установлен, я понимаю
а если через докер, то не очень, как это сделать без сварма или чего-то подобного
источник

EG

Eugene Girtcius in Airflow
там же даже сеть между контейнерами по умолчанию не видна с других хостов
источник

ME

Max Efremov in Airflow
Возможно, тут лучше кубер взять? Там это из коробки вроде бы
источник

GB

Georgy Borodin in Airflow
Eugene Girtcius
да, это я видел, вопрос, как утилизировать)
когда airflow локально установлен, я понимаю
а если через докер, то не очень, как это сделать без сварма или чего-то подобного
Вот похоже на нормальный вариант про swarm https://medium.com/analytics-vidhya/setting-up-airflow-to-run-with-docker-swarms-orchestration-b16459cd03a2

А так вроде кубер самое удобное решение для таких задач. Но я кручу в амазоновском ECS и пока не страдаю от куберпроблем
источник

ME

Max Efremov in Airflow
Сварм - по сути аналог кубера (если честно, я думал он уже всё)
источник

GB

Georgy Borodin in Airflow
Max Efremov
Сварм - по сути аналог кубера (если честно, я думал он уже всё)
Ну да, он какой-то мертворожденный
источник

EG

Eugene Girtcius in Airflow
Georgy Borodin
Вот похоже на нормальный вариант про swarm https://medium.com/analytics-vidhya/setting-up-airflow-to-run-with-docker-swarms-orchestration-b16459cd03a2

А так вроде кубер самое удобное решение для таких задач. Но я кручу в амазоновском ECS и пока не страдаю от куберпроблем
спасибо, поковыряю,
похоже, что пора осваивать кубер)
источник

IL

Ilya Lozhkin in Airflow
Станислав Горчаков
ок, но как все равно создавать таблицы в мета базе?)
Мб в plugins посмотреть?
источник

СГ

Станислав Горчаков... in Airflow
Ilya Lozhkin
Мб в plugins посмотреть?
Да, сделал уже, но там нужно руками прописывать само создание таблицы, и airflow при запуске трегирит этот скрипт
источник